To comprise, the property offers a tarmacadam driveway to the front with an entrance hall and porch leading into the property. The kitchen, lounge and stairs to the first floor can be reached through this hall. The second reception room study is accessed via the main lounge area. The kitchen provides a sliding door to the conservatory, and a door into additional entrance hall with potential to use as a utility and garage. Upstairs are three bedrooms, a bathroom and separate w.c. room. The rear offers a garden.
